Embodiment 1
[0024] Add water to the water glass solution with a modulus of 2.4 to prepare 1000 g of water glass solution with a mass fraction of 15%, add 0.4 g of dodecyltrimethylammonium bromide, and stir for 20 minutes under heating at 70 ° C, with a stirring speed of 100 m After stirring uniformly, carbon dioxide was introduced into the mixture to prepare white carbon black. After fully reacting, the pH value of the product was 8.2. After aging for 2 hours, the white carbon black slurry was obtained by solid-liquid separation. The finished product of white carbon black is obtained by spray drying, and the performance test of white carbon black is carried out.
Embodiment 2
[0026] Add water to the water glass solution with a modulus of 2.8 to prepare 1000g of water glass solution with a mass fraction of 10%, add 0.2g of tetradecyltrimethylammonium bromide, and stir for 20min under heating at 65°C, with a stirring speed of 160m After stirring uniformly, carbon dioxide was introduced to prepare white carbon black. After fully reacting, the pH value of the product was 8.4. After aging for 1 hour, the white carbon black slurry was obtained by solid-liquid separation. The finished product of white carbon black is obtained by flash drying, and the performance test of white carbon black is carried out.
Embodiment 3
[0028] Add water to the water glass solution with a modulus of 3.2 to prepare 1000 g of water glass solution with a mass fraction of 16%, add 0.8 g of hexadecyltrimethylammonium bromide, and stir for 20 minutes under heating at 80 ° C, with a stirring speed of 100 m After 1 / min, carbon dioxide was introduced to prepare white carbon black after uniform stirring, and the pH value of the product after full reaction was 8.5. After aging for 2 hours, the white carbon black slurry was obtained by solid-liquid separation. Oven drying is adopted to obtain the finished product of white carbon black, and the performance test of white carbon black is carried out.
